The State of Plastic Processing in France

Analyzing the intersection of industrial demand and the AGEC law's impact on film production.

In France, the demand for high-quality packaging remains strong, yet the industry is under immense pressure from the Anti-Waste for a Circular Economy (AGEC) law. This has shifted the focus of the blown film extrusion machine market toward materials that are either fully recyclable or biodegradable.

French manufacturers are increasingly investing in high-precision film blowing machine technology to reduce material waste (scrap) during the startup phase, as raw material costs in Europe remain volatile due to energy fluctuations.

The regional landscape is characterized by a move toward "Industry 4.0," where the integration of a blown film line is no longer just about output, but about digital monitoring and carbon footprint tracking to meet corporate ESG goals.

Evolution and Trajectory of Film Production in France

From traditional LDPE production to advanced multi-layer sustainable extrusion.

Market Development History

During the 1990s and early 2000s, the French market relied heavily on single-layer lown film machine setups focusing on volume for agricultural and basic retail packaging.

Between 2010 and 2020, a technical shift occurred toward 3-layer and 5-layer co-extrusion. This allowed French producers to combine barrier properties with recycled content, significantly optimizing the performance of a blown film line.

Post-2020, the focus has transitioned to "smart extrusion," where AI-driven temperature control and automatic bubble stability systems became the gold standard for high-end French production facilities.

Frequently Asked Questions in France

Expert answers to common technical and regulatory queries.

How does your blown film production line comply with EU CE certification?

All our equipment undergoes rigorous safety and electrical testing to ensure full compliance with CE standards, including emergency stop systems and shielded electrical cabinets required for French industrial sites.

Can a film blowing machine be adjusted for compostable PLA resins?

Yes, we provide specialized screw designs and temperature control profiles specifically optimized for the lower melting points and thermal sensitivity of PLA and PBAT resins.

What is the average energy saving of a modern blown film extrusion machine?

By utilizing AC frequency converters and high-efficiency ceramic heaters, our latest machines reduce energy consumption by 15-25% compared to legacy equipment.

How do I maintain a blown film line to ensure long-term bubble stability?

We recommend regular calibration of the air ring and ensuring the cooling fans are free of debris. Our smart control systems also provide alerts for abnormal pressure changes.

Is the lown film machine suitable for high-percentage recycled PE?

Our machines feature advanced degassing systems and high-mixing screws that prevent contamination and maintain film strength even when using high levels of PCR material.
